vb编程都有什么功能
-
VB编程是Visual Basic编程的简称,是一种面向对象的编程语言。VB编程具有以下功能:
-
界面设计:VB编程可以用于创建用户界面,通过拖放控件的方式轻松设计窗体和交互界面。可以添加按钮、文本框、列表框等控件,实现丰富的用户界面。
-
数据处理:VB编程可以处理各种数据类型,包括整数、浮点数、字符串、日期等。可以进行数学运算、字符串处理、日期计算等操作,方便数据处理和计算。
-
文件操作:VB编程可以实现对文件的读写操作,可以创建、打开、关闭和删除文件。可以读取和写入文件的内容,实现文件的读写操作。
-
数据库操作:VB编程可以连接到各种数据库,如SQL Server、Access、MySQL等。可以执行数据库的查询、插入、更新和删除操作,方便进行数据库管理和数据的增删改查。
-
图形绘制:VB编程可以实现图形的绘制和显示,可以绘制直线、矩形、椭圆等图形,并进行颜色、样式、填充等设置。
-
网络通信:VB编程可以实现网络通信功能,可以通过TCP/IP协议与远程服务器进行通信,可以发送和接收数据,实现客户端和服务器之间的交互。
-
错误处理:VB编程可以实现错误处理,可以捕获和处理程序运行时的错误,避免程序崩溃或出现异常情况。
-
自定义函数和类:VB编程可以定义自己的函数和类,方便重复使用和代码的封装。可以创建自己的函数库,提高代码的复用性和可维护性。
总的来说,VB编程具有丰富的功能,可以用于实现各种应用程序,包括窗体应用程序、控制台应用程序、数据库应用程序等。它易于学习和使用,适合初学者和中级开发者。
1年前 -
-
VB(Visual Basic)编程是一种基于事件驱动的编程语言,它旨在帮助开发者轻松创建和管理Windows应用程序。VB编程具有以下功能:
-
创建用户界面:VB编程支持创建图形化用户界面(GUI),开发者可以使用拖放功能快速设计和构建窗体、控件和菜单等元素。通过VB编程,可以创建具有按钮、文本框、列表框、复选框等控件的应用程序界面,提供直观的用户交互体验。
-
动态数据处理:VB编程允许开发者处理和管理数据,包括读取、写入、修改和删除数据等操作。通过VB编程可以连接数据库,执行SQL查询,实现数据的存储、检索和更新等功能。此外,VB还支持文件操作,可以读写文件,对文件进行操作。
-
事件处理:VB编程基于事件驱动的方式,可以对用户的操作做出响应。开发者可以编写事件处理程序来处理用户在界面上进行的操作,例如按钮点击、菜单选择、鼠标移动等。通过事件处理,可以实现对用户交互的灵活控制,使程序能够根据用户的操作做出相应的反应。
-
错误处理:VB编程提供了丰富的错误处理机制,开发者可以通过编写错误处理代码来捕获和处理程序中可能出现的错误。通过错误处理,可以提高程序的稳定性和可靠性,避免出现未处理的异常情况。
-
与其他应用程序的互操作性:VB编程支持与其他应用程序进行互操作,例如Microsoft Office套件中的Word、Excel、Access等。开发者可以使用VB编程的功能来操作和控制这些应用程序,实现数据的交互和共享。通过VB编程,可以轻松实现自动化操作,提高工作效率。
1年前 -
-
VB(Visual Basic)编程是一种基于事件驱动的编程语言,主要用于开发Windows平台下的应用程序。它有丰富的功能和特性,以下是VB编程常用的功能:
-
用户界面设计:VB提供了强大的用户界面设计器,可以通过拖拽控件和属性设置来创建用户界面。开发人员可以使用VB提供的控件(如按钮、文本框、标签等)来构建交互式界面,并使用属性和事件来设置控件的行为和响应。
-
数据库连接和操作:VB具有强大的数据库连接和操作功能,可以使用ADO(ActiveX Data Objects)或DAO(Data Access Objects)来连接各种数据库管理系统(如SQL Server、Oracle等),并执行数据库的查询、插入、更新和删除等操作。开发人员可以使用VB提供的数据控件和组件来简化数据库操作的过程。
-
文件和文件夹操作:VB可以进行文件和文件夹的创建、读取、写入和删除等操作。它提供了一些用于文件和文件夹操作的对象和方法,如File对象和Folder对象,开发人员可以使用这些对象和方法来管理和操作计算机中的文件和文件夹。
-
网络通信:VB可以进行网络通信,包括使用TCP/IP协议进行网络连接、发送和接收数据等操作。开发人员可以使用VB提供的网络编程库或第三方库来实现网络通信功能,实现客户端和服务器之间的数据交换和通信。
-
安全性和加密:VB提供了一些安全性和加密的功能,可以对数据进行加密和解密,保护数据的安全性。开发人员可以使用VB提供的加密算法和方法,如MD5、SHA等,对敏感数据进行加密操作,并使用密钥进行数据解密。
-
多媒体处理:VB可以进行多媒体处理,包括音频、视频、图片等的播放、录制、编辑和转换等操作。开发人员可以使用VB提供的多媒体控件和组件来实现多媒体处理功能,如MediaPlayer控件、PictureBox控件等。
-
打印和报表:VB可以进行打印和报表的生成,包括打印文档、打印预览、报表设计和报表导出等操作。开发人员可以使用VB提供的打印控件和报表控件,如PrintDocument控件、Crystal Reports控件等,实现打印和报表生成功能。
-
多线程编程:VB可以进行多线程编程,实现并发执行和异步操作。开发人员可以使用VB提供的多线程相关的类和方法,如Thread类、ThreadPool类等,创建和管理多个线程,实现复杂的并发操作。
总之,VB编程具有丰富的功能和特性,开发人员可以根据需求选择合适的功能来实现各种应用程序的开发。
1年前 -